Job Description:
We are seeking a talented and motivated Product Development Engineer with a proven track record of implementing best in class processes within a complex design and manufacturing environment. This role will report to the Manager of Product Development and is an integral member of the Design Engineering Services team. You will be responsible for applying design for X (DFx) principles during new product introduction (NPI) of a wide range of products from initial concept to beta. You will work to integrate customer scaling requirements for safety, manufacturability, deployability, and supportability into new product designs. Additionally, you will work cross-functionally to develop best in class DFx feedback and services; guide product lifecycle changes, lead bill of material (BOM) strategy, lead technology feasibility and improvement projects, and drive to technical root cause utilizing advanced problem solving. The successful candidate will have extensive experience in both design and manufacturing combined with capability of making wide-ranging business decisions on behalf of the organization.

Key job responsibilities
Actively support and foster a culture of inclusion.
Provide design for X guidance/feedback on electromechanical designs.
Guide best practices on manufacturing tolerances using GD&T.
Launch prototype tooling with accelerated schedules and assess project risk.
Leverage knowledge of multiple production processes to identify risk to programs and provide mitigation strategies.
Analyze new products dimensional data.
Drive internal and external DFMEA reviews.
Solve technical problems across a broad set of design and manufacturing commodities.
Mentor team members and design engineers.
Propose design changes that will enhance product manufacturability and testability.
Evaluate and approve Design Engineering Changes Orders (DECOs) and Engineering Change Orders (ECOs)
Implement best practices for engineering standards (ex. IPC-620 WHMA Class II)
Analyze NPI failures to identify root cause and drive improvements through future DFx cycles.
Effectively write White Papers (WP) and Manufacturing Concept Papers (MCP) to inform and influence teams and stakeholders
Take ownership to identify issues/problems and drives them to completion with little oversight
High level of attention to detail but flexibility to enable to business to move at a high velocity.
Navigate projects consisting of a high level of ambiguity and provide guidance to multiple partners.
